Stroll: New Aston Martin factory 'the reverse' of McLaren's MTC

Aston Martin team owner Lawrence Stroll says the F1 outfit's future state-of-the-art factory that broke ground last week will embody a vision opposite that of McLaren's Technology Center. Upon Stroll's takeover along with a consortium of investors of Force India in 2018, the Canadian billionaire devised a significant investment plan to equip the Silverstone-based outfit with a new facility and campus. The team's $150m-$200m project - the start of which was delayed due to the global pandemic - is expected to be completed by the end of 2022 or in the early part of 2023.
